Convoy Recognized for Consistently Receiving Charity Navigator’s Highest Award

Reported by Convoy of Hope

Convoy of Hope is honored to be ranked among Charity Navigator’s list of “10 Charities with the Most Consecutive 4-Star Ratings.”

For 18 years in a row, Convoy of Hope has received a 4-star rating from Charity Navigator — the highest award the organization has to offer. Now, we are pleased to see Convoy of Hope listed among other long-standing 4-star award winners such as United Way of Central Alabama, American Kidney Fund, and Kids Alive International.

“To be successful, organizations must be high performers consistently, year after year,” Charity Navigator said on its website. “These ten charities have earned the most consecutive 4-star ratings demonstrating an ongoing fiscal excellence. They are well-positioned to pursue and achieve long-term change.” 

Charity Navigator rates nonprofit organizations based on several factors including accountability, transparency, and financial health. The goal of their rating system is to show, at a glance, how efficiently nonprofits will use donors’ funds. Their rating system ranges from “CN Advisory” (a step below their zero-star rating) to four stars, awarded when a charity “… exceeds industry standards and outperforms most charities in its Cause.” 

Convoy of Hope considers it a huge honor to consistently receive high marks from Charity Navigator. We are grateful for those who support us and allow us to do the work that we do around the world.
